Things needed
- A printed color picture of an expansive face
- A jar to fit the head into
- Scissors
- Glue
- Wig hair
Setting up the cut off Head
Discover a colored container that has blemishes. This will give the head
an appearance of being protected in formaldehyde for some time.
Get an incredible face picture and it ought to be pragmatic; a Photoshopped picture of a genuine individual's mug is perfect. A tormented appearance adds to the impact, so search for squinty eyes, puffiness, an open mouth or other confirmation that the giver was not willing.
Print out the picture you've picked and verify it fits your jug once it’s moved up and embedded. Expand or decrease the dimension if required.

Give the 3-D appearance to the face
Cut little bits of the wig and paste them in the face picture. This step
is not completely important, however without a doubt includes a touch of
three-dimensional authenticity if done inconspicuously.
Place the hair arbitrarily over the temple/hairline, attempting to make
it seem regular and in disorder.
Permit the paste underneath the hair to dry totally, then move up the
face and insert it into the container. Spread it out from within with your
fingers on the off chance that it remains excessively firmly rolled. Revise the
hair with a finger embedded between the face picture and the jug.
Screw the cap of the jar. In the event that you'd like, feel free to get
inventive with some trickled on flame wax or a length of rattan or rope tied
around the jug's neck.
Final step
Now that you are done with the halloween prop creation you need to find a place to
keep it. Place your unpleasant skull among the gristly products in an enchantress's
Kitchen, in a few wads of red-colored "bleeding" cotton as an evil
centerpiece or on a rack where party visitors wouldn't dare to find it. They'll
never trust you were the "brains" behind the prop – or that it was
very easy to make.
